Lee, Yin surge atop Riviera leaderboard after 2 rounds

LOS ANGELES — Alison Lee seized a share of the lead at the 81st US Women’s Open on Friday (Saturday in Manila) with a second-round 68 in her native Los Angeles area, joining Ruoning Yin at 4-under 138 atop a crowded leaderboard at Riviera. World No. 1 Nelly Korda jumped into the hunt for her first Women’s Open title by shooting the day’s lowest round at 67, leaving her just two shots back after struggling Thursday.
